About the Role
Appliance Distributors Unlimited (ADU) is seeking a reliable and motivated Appliance Install Assistant to support our installation team in Easton, MD. Since 1982, ADU has been the Mid-Atlantic's most trusted source for luxury kitchen and laundry appliances. This hands-on appliance installer role offers the opportunity to learn a skilled trade while assisting with delivering, handling, and installing high-end appliances in residential and commercial settings across the Eastern Shore and surrounding areas.
What You'll Do
- Assist with delivering and handling luxury appliances including refrigerators, dishwashers, ovens, washing machines, and dryers
- Perform installations of various high-end kitchen appliances in residential and commercial properties
- Safely load and unload appliances from trucks
- Transport large appliances and handle heavy loads up to 100 lbs independently
- Push, pull, lift, and move loads up to 1,000 pounds with assistance using straps, dollies, and team support
- Interact professionally with customers and team members to ensure high standards of professionalism
- Maintain a professional and clean work environment
- Perform frequent standing, walking, stooping, climbing, and crouching as required for appliance installation work
What You'll Need
- Valid driver's license with an acceptable driving record
- Department of Transportation (DOT) certification or ability to obtain upon hire
- Ability to pass background check and motor vehicle record (MVR) check
- Capacity to safely lift and move appliances up to 100 lbs independently
- High school diploma or equivalent preferred
- 1–2 years of appliance installation or related field experience is a plus
- Basic mechanical skills and familiarity with hand and power tools
- Strong work ethic, reliability, and self-motivation
- Ability to work both indoors and outdoors in variable weather conditions
- Good ver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ills
- Willingness to learn and grow in a hands-on trade
Compensation & Benefits
Pay: $18.00–$25.00 per hour based on experience. Benefits: Medical, dental, and vision insurance (eligible after 60 days); 401(k) retirement plan with company match up to 4% (eligible after 6 months); paid time off accrued (eligible after 90 days); paid holidays after 90 days including New Year's Day, Memorial Day, Independence Day, Labor Day, Thanksgiving, and Christmas. Work Schedule: Monday–Friday, 7:00 a.m. to 3:30 p.m., with overtime as needed based on project demands.
